Northlake, Charlotte, NC rent trends

Rental prices in Northlake, Charlotte, NC have decreased by 1.1% over the past year. The average rent moved from $1,549 to $1,532.

    Northlake, Charlotte, NC demographics

    In total, Northlake, Charlotte, NC has 8,970 residents, 4,727 women and 4,243 men, per U.S. Census recent estimates. Statistics show that the median age of Northlake’s population is 35.

    Northlake, Charlotte, NC households

    There is a total of 3,695 households in Northlake, Charlotte, NC. Of these, 1,043 have children and 2,652 are without children. Per Census Bureau’s most current estimates, 2,177 family households and 1,518 non-family households live in this area. The size of a household in Northlake is 2.4 people, on average. The median household annual income in Northlake equals $73,656, and the monthly housing costs equal $1,503.

    Northlake, Charlotte, NC education statistics

    According to data from the U.S. Census Bureau, 4% of the population in Northlake, Charlotte, NC have no high school education, 28% went to high-school, and 24% have partially completed college. Moreover, 11% of the population hold an Associate Degree, 22% hold a Bachelor Degree, and 11% hold a Graduate Degree.
